EDUCATION
-University: University of Sports and Physical Education, Budapest
TEACHING AND COACHING EXPERIENCE
-University of Hungarian Sport and Physical Education Budapest(as teacher for
6 years).I was the”Teacher of the year”in 95.-96. at the Athletics Department.
-Hungarian National Team coach
-Kuwait National Team coach
– University of Hungarian Sports and Physical Education Budapest as coach from 2002 until
2011. Also supervised graduate students at the same institution.
PRESENT WORKPLACE
– Silverado High Shool (Las Vegas NV) pole vault,high jump,triple jump coach.
COACHING CAREER WITH THE FOLLOWING PUPILS:
-Laszlo Szalma: long jump 830cm.
-Jozsef Jambor:high jump 227cm.
-Jozsef Hoffer:decathlon 7.976 points
-Klara Novobaczky:long jump 676 cm.
-Zsuzsa Vanyek:long jump 681cm. heptathlon 6.238 points
-Ferenc Salbert:pole vault 570cm.
PERSONAL SPORT ACHIEVEMENTS
-Hungarian pole vault champion 1980 (520cm)
-Hungarian record holder (pole vault 2x) 1979
-Universiade 8th. Place 1979 -European cup 2nd. Place 1979
BEST PERSONAL PERFORMANCES
-Pole: 540cm. 1983 ,100m.:10.5 sec. 1982 ,Long jump:773cm. 1979
